Patent number: 11426244Abstract: A medical or dental system with at least one first transmitting and/or receiving unit and at least one second transmitting and/or receiving unit, wherein the at least two transmitting and/or receiving units are designed for the capacitive coupling of electric signals into and/or out of a human body, so that an electric path which extends through the human body of the user and/or of the person to be treated can be established for the transmission of electric signals between the at least one first transmitting and/or receiving unit and the at least one second transmitting and/or receiving unit, in order to transmit data between the at least two transmitting and/or receiving units.Type: GrantFiled: February 26, 2020Date of Patent: August 30, 2022Assignee: W&H Dentalwerk Bürmoos GmbHInventors: Rainer Schröck, Wolfgang Tannebaum

Patent number: 9377775Abstract: A method and device for programming a cordless handpiece used for root canal treatment and having a first memory and a tool holder for a treatment tool are described. The method includes providing a first data volume having a plurality of data sets in a second memory separate from the first memory, each of the data sets comprising at least one parameter assigned to the cordless handpiece and/or to the treatment tool, selecting at least some of the data sets from the first data volume in the second memory, transmitting the selected data sets from the second memory to the first memory of the handpiece, and selecting a data set from the updated first memory for operation of the handpiece.Type: GrantFiled: December 19, 2014Date of Patent: June 28, 2016Assignee: W&H Dentalwerk Bürmoos GmbHInventors: Gerald Helfenbein, Stefan Putz, Rainer Schröck

Patent number: 7535135Abstract: A brushless electric motor which has a rotor magnet, a coil apparatus for electromagnetically driving the rotor magnet, a rotor shaft for transmitting a rotary movement, which is firmly connected to the rotor magnet and runs through a rotation axis of the rotor magnet, and at least one electromagnetic transducer element for detection of the magnetic field of the rotor magnet, in which the at least one electromagnetic transducer element is arranged outside the axial extent of the rotor magnet with respect to the rotation axis, and is arranged essentially within the maximum radial extent of the rotor magnet. The invention also relates to an instrument for a medical, in particular a dental, apparatus having a brushless electric motor such as this.Type: GrantFiled: May 27, 2004Date of Patent: May 19, 2009Assignee: W&H Dentalwerk Burmoos GmbHInventors: Richard Kardeis, Roland Sevcik, Johann Eibl, Rainer Schröck, Harald Schörghofer, Rainer Mackinger, Wolfgang Wendtner, Dieter Köbel
